Definition

The prefix 'pre-' is used to indicate something that occurs before another event or condition. This term is commonly seen in various contexts, including language, science, and everyday conversation, where it helps to convey a sense of timing or order. In relation to common verbs, it can modify the meaning of a verb by placing it in a temporal context, indicating that the action or state happens prior to another referenced action.

5 Must Know Facts For Your Next Test

  1. 'pre-' is derived from Latin and has been adopted into English as a common prefix.
  2. When used with verbs, 'pre-' can change the action's meaning significantly, such as in 'prepare' (to make ready beforehand).
  3. It often conveys a sense of anticipation or prior occurrence, impacting how we understand sequences of actions.
  4. In scientific terms, 'pre-' may describe processes that take place before a certain stage, such as 'premature' or 'preemptive.'
  5. 'pre-' is frequently used in terms related to education, like 'prerequisite,' indicating a requirement that must be met beforehand.
